Further Reading
Account of the mid-air collision on 23 June 1944 during 97 Squadron formation flying practice from RAF Coningsby. Lancaster ND981 OF-T piloted by Fl/Lt Ted Perkins had its tail removed when ME625 dropped onto it from above. The aircraft broke apart at 1,000 ft; Sgt Coman bailed out and survived.

Account of Lancaster ME625 OF-O piloted by Australian Fl/Lt Van Raalte. The aircraft became trapped in the slipstream of the lead Lancaster during a gentle turn, causing the fatal collision. ME625 crashed two miles from ND981 with no survivors.
